Selection Guidance for Infant Ear Ornaments
Careful consideration should be given to various factors when selecting circular ear adornments for infant girls. Prioritizing safety, comfort, and appropriate design is essential.
Tip 1: Material Selection: Opt for hypoallergenic metals such as 14k gold, titanium, or surgical stainless steel to minimize the risk of allergic reactions. Avoid materials containing nickel, a common allergen.
Tip 2: Size and Diameter: Choose a small diameter to prevent the infant from grabbing or pulling on the jewelry. A snug fit reduces the risk of entanglement with clothing or bedding.
Tip 3: Closure Type: Lever-back or screw-back closures are recommended for their secure fastening. These designs are less likely to detach accidentally, reducing the risk of choking hazards.
Tip 4: Smooth Edges: Ensure that the chosen design features smooth, rounded edges to prevent skin irritation or scratching. Avoid styles with sharp points or embellishments that could pose a risk.
Tip 5: Weight Considerations: Select lightweight designs to minimize discomfort and prevent stretching of the earlobe. Heavy jewelry can cause irritation and potential tissue damage.
Tip 6: Regular Inspection: Routinely inspect the ear ornaments for any signs of damage or loosening of the closure. Address any issues promptly to prevent potential hazards.
Tip 7: Professional Piercing: Ensure that the ear piercing is performed by a qualified professional using sterile techniques and equipment. Proper aftercare is crucial to prevent infection.
Adhering to these guidelines can significantly reduce potential risks and ensure a safe and comfortable experience when adorning an infant with ear jewelry.

1. Material Hypoallergenicity
The selection of materials for infant ear ornaments is paramount due to the heightened sensitivity of a baby’s skin. Material hypoallergenicity directly impacts the safety and comfort of the wearer. The use of non-hypoallergenic metals, such as those containing nickel, can induce allergic contact dermatitis, characterized by redness, itching, and inflammation at the piercing site. This adverse reaction can cause significant discomfort and potentially lead to secondary infections. Hypoallergenic materials, conversely, minimize these risks. For instance, 14k gold, surgical stainless steel, and titanium are commonly recommended because they exhibit a reduced propensity to trigger allergic responses. These materials undergo refining processes that remove or significantly reduce allergenic components. Thus, the causal relationship between material composition and skin reaction underscores the imperative of selecting hypoallergenic options.
The practical significance of this understanding is evident in preventative measures. When purchasing ear ornaments for infants, parents and caregivers should actively seek products explicitly labeled as hypoallergenic and inquire about the metal composition. Reputable jewelers provide detailed information regarding material specifications, empowering informed decision-making. Failure to prioritize hypoallergenic materials can lead to unnecessary distress for the infant, requiring medical intervention and potentially precluding the continued use of ear ornaments. The increased prevalence of metal allergies necessitates vigilance in material selection.
In summary, prioritizing hypoallergenic materials is not merely a cosmetic consideration; it is a critical aspect of safeguarding infant health and well-being. By understanding the connection between material composition and potential allergic reactions, informed choices can be made, mitigating risks and ensuring that the adornment does not compromise the infant’s comfort or health. While challenges may arise in identifying genuinely hypoallergenic products amidst misleading marketing claims, a focus on reputable sources and detailed material information provides a pathway to responsible purchasing.
2. Diameter Appropriateness
The diameter of infant ear ornaments is a critical factor directly impacting safety and comfort. In the context of jewelry for young girls, an appropriate diameter minimizes the risk of entanglement and potential injury.
- Reduced Entanglement Risk
A smaller diameter lessens the likelihood of the jewelry becoming caught on clothing, bedding, or other objects. Entanglement can lead to discomfort, skin irritation, or, in severe cases, tearing of the earlobe. For example, a small diameter keeps the jewelry closer to the ear, minimizing the opportunity for external objects to interact with it.
- Minimized Pulling Hazard
Infants frequently explore their surroundings through touch, including their own bodies. A smaller diameter reduces the leverage an infant has to pull on the jewelry, which could otherwise cause pain or damage to the piercing site. This is especially important during the initial healing period after piercing.
- Enhanced Comfort
Excessively large diameters can be cumbersome and uncomfortable for an infant. The increased weight and size can irritate the skin and disrupt sleep. Selecting a diameter that is proportionate to the infant’s earlobe ensures a more comfortable wearing experience.
- Aesthetic Proportionality
While safety is paramount, the aesthetic appearance of the jewelry should also be considered. A smaller diameter typically provides a more delicate and proportional look on a baby’s ear, avoiding an overly prominent or gaudy appearance. The visual balance enhances the overall presentation.
In conclusion, diameter appropriateness in infant ear adornments is not merely a stylistic preference, but a fundamental consideration for safety and comfort. The correlation between a well-chosen diameter and reduced risk of entanglement, minimized pulling hazard, enhanced comfort, and aesthetic proportionality underscores the importance of careful selection. These factors combine to ensure the well-being of the infant while allowing for the adornment of jewelry.
3. Closure Security
Closure security, pertaining to infant ear ornaments, is a paramount consideration due to the inherent vulnerabilities of young children. Insecure closures present potential hazards, necessitating stringent design and testing standards.
- Choking Hazard Mitigation
A primary concern associated with inadequate closure security is the risk of detachment and subsequent ingestion of the jewelry. Infants explore their environment orally, increasing the likelihood of a dislodged earring becoming a choking hazard. Secure closures, such as screw-backs or lever-backs with robust mechanisms, significantly reduce the probability of accidental detachment. For instance, a lever-back closure with a tight spring mechanism requires deliberate force to open, minimizing the risk of unintentional release.
- Skin Irritation Prevention
Loose or poorly designed closures can cause skin irritation and discomfort. Sharp edges or protruding components may rub against the infant’s delicate skin, leading to inflammation and potential infection. Well-designed closures incorporate smooth, rounded edges and are constructed from hypoallergenic materials to minimize these adverse effects. Regular inspection of the closure mechanism is crucial to ensure its integrity and prevent irritation.
- Loss Prevention
While not a safety concern, insecure closures frequently result in the loss of the jewelry. This not only represents a financial inconvenience but also exposes the infant to potential hazards if the dislodged earring is not promptly retrieved. Secure closures offer a greater degree of retention, minimizing the chances of loss during normal activity.
- Material Degradation Over Time
The structural integrity of the closure is related to materials, manufacturing, usage and time. Closures made from weak or inappropriate materials may fatigue, lose their grip, corrode, or otherwise deteriorate; compromising their design. The implications of material degradation can lead to the three facets explained above if left unnoticed. Inspecting and properly caring for the materials can extend product lifetime while minimizing the possibility of failure.
In conclusion, the selection of ear ornaments with secure closures is not merely an aesthetic consideration but a fundamental aspect of infant safety. By prioritizing designs that minimize the risk of detachment, prevent skin irritation, and resist material degradation, caregivers can ensure that the adornment does not compromise the well-being of the child.

6. Inspection Regularity
The concept of inspection regularity is intrinsically linked to ensuring the safety and suitability of circular ear adornments worn by infant girls. The very nature of jewelry, especially when worn by a population unable to articulate discomfort or recognize potential hazards, necessitates diligent and routine examination. A direct cause-and-effect relationship exists: infrequent inspection increases the likelihood of undetected damage or loosening, while regular inspection allows for timely identification and mitigation of potential risks. The importance of inspection regularity stems from its role as a proactive safety measure, preventing minor issues from escalating into significant problems. These issues can include but are not limited to: loose closures, sharp edges due to wear, material degradation, and general cleanliness. Real-life examples demonstrate that early detection of a loose closure, through regular inspection, can prevent a choking hazard. Similarly, identifying a developing sharp edge allows for prompt removal and replacement of the jewelry, preventing skin irritation or infection. Therefore, this level of vigilance serves a protective function crucial to the health and well-being of the infant.
Practical application of this principle involves establishing a consistent inspection schedule. Parents and caregivers should visually examine the ear ornaments daily, paying close attention to the integrity of the closure, the smoothness of the edges, and the overall condition of the materials. Tactile inspection, gently running fingertips over the surface of the jewelry, can reveal subtle imperfections not readily visible. Furthermore, jewelry should be cleaned regularly with a mild, hypoallergenic solution to remove accumulated debris that can harbor bacteria and contribute to skin irritation. Any signs of damage, loosening, or material degradation warrant immediate action, such as tightening screws, smoothing rough edges (if possible and safe), or replacing the jewelry entirely. Furthermore, after events or incidents that may have caused stress or damage to the jewelry, a careful inspection is especially prudent.
In summary, inspection regularity is not a mere suggestion but a foundational element of responsible jewelry use for infant girls. Its proactive nature allows for the timely identification and resolution of potential hazards, safeguarding the child’s health and well-being. While challenges may arise in maintaining consistent diligence amidst the demands of infant care, the potential consequences of neglect underscore the imperative of prioritizing this practice. Linking inspection regularity to other safety considerations, such as material selection and design appropriateness, creates a comprehensive approach to minimizing risks associated with infant ear adornment.
Frequently Asked Questions
This section addresses common inquiries regarding the selection, safety, and maintenance of circular ear adornments intended for infant girls.
Question 1: At what age is it generally considered safe to pierce an infant’s ears for the purpose of wearing this style of ear ornament?
There is no universally agreed-upon age. Medical professionals recommend postponing ear piercing until the infant has received at least one tetanus vaccination and is old enough to not pull at the jewelry. Consultation with a pediatrician is advised before proceeding.
Question 2: What materials are deemed safest to minimize the risk of allergic reactions in infants with sensitive skin?
Hypoallergenic materials such as 14k gold, titanium, and surgical stainless steel are recommended. Avoid jewelry containing nickel, a common allergen. Verify the metal composition and ensure it meets established safety standards.
Question 3: What constitutes an appropriate diameter size to prevent entanglement or discomfort?
A smaller diameter is generally preferred. The jewelry should fit snugly against the earlobe without causing constriction or irritation. A diameter that is too large increases the risk of snagging on clothing or bedding.
Question 4: What closure types offer the highest degree of security to prevent accidental dislodgement and potential choking hazards?
Screw-back and lever-back closures are generally regarded as more secure than standard butterfly closures. Inspect the closure mechanism regularly to ensure its integrity and prevent loosening.
Question 5: How frequently should circular ear adornments be inspected for signs of damage, wear, or potential hazards?
Ear ornaments should be visually inspected daily for loose closures, sharp edges, or other signs of wear. A tactile inspection, gently running fingertips over the surface, can reveal subtle imperfections.
Question 6: What cleaning practices are recommended to maintain hygiene and minimize the risk of infection at the piercing site?
The jewelry and piercing site should be cleaned regularly with a mild, hypoallergenic soap and water solution. Avoid harsh chemicals or abrasive cleaners that can irritate the skin.
